#65fab4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65fab4 is composed of 39.6% red, 98%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 151.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 68.8%. #65fab4 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#00f569.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#65fab4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#65fab4 has RGB values of R:101, G:250,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6683316.

Hex triplet 65fab4 #65fab4
RGB Decimal 101, 250, 180 rgb(101,250,180)
RGB Percent 39.6, 98, 70.6 rgb(39.6%,98%,70.6%)
CMYK 60, 0, 28, 2
HSL 151.8°, 93.7, 68.8 hsl(151.8,93.7%,68.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 151.8°, 59.6, 98
Web Safe 66ffcc #66ffcc
CIE-LAB 89.125, -55.542, 21.944
XYZ 47.787, 74.429, 55.025
xyY 0.27, 0.42, 74.429
CIE-LCH 89.125, 59.72, 158.441
CIE-LUV 89.125, -62.616, 41.229
Hunter-Lab 86.272, -52.103, 22.575
Binary 01100101, 11111010, 10110100

Shades and Tints of #65fab4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011109 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#65fab4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eb1b0 is the less saturated color, while #65fab4 is the most saturated one.
